Output 62144a74314ae1921466004fcd7e8507daed88d6e4c99e9bc5cce54f290f26a1:10

value
37693436
script pubkey
OP_0 OP_PUSHBYTES_32 a2bf621c5ab119833a0e3331ec6abb7d68bbe77005bc77ba1e04a1055b4c46e9
address
bc1q52lky8z6kyvcxwswxvc7c64m045themsqk780ws7qjss2k6vgm5sma7am4
transaction
62144a74314ae1921466004fcd7e8507daed88d6e4c99e9bc5cce54f290f26a1
spent
true